This picture of a wool shed was taken in the Boyce Thompson Arboretum located southeast of Phoenix.
Boyce Thompson Arboretum State Park is Arizona's oldest and largest botanical garden. In the park are desert plants, towering trees, cacti, sheer mountain cliffs, a streamside forest, panoramic vistas, wildlife, a desert lake, a hidden canyon, as well as specialty gardens.
